Notes from the organizer: Welcome to the group stages of The Big Aegilops Bash! You have one month to complete all games against your group opponents. Best of luck! Any questions, please ask. Remember: The top 3 losers as well as the leader of each group will succeed into going through to the knockout stages, in which Aegilops 15s shall be played.

Ran from: 2 February – 2 March 2015. Format: Aegilops 9. Matches: One-off. Approved.

Organizers: Adam Finlay.

Fixtures: 91. Completed: 83.
